x86/topology: Remove x86_smt_flags and use cpu_smt_flags directly
x86_*_flags() wrappers were introduced with commitd3d37d850d("x86/sched: Add SD_ASYM_PACKING flags to x86 ITMT CPU") to add x86_sched_itmt_flags() in addition to the default domain flags for SMT and MC domain. commit995998ebde("x86/sched: Remove SD_ASYM_PACKING from the SMT domain flags") removed the ITMT flags for SMT domain but not the x86_smt_flags() wrappers which directly returns cpu_smt_flags(). Remove x86_smt_flags() and directly use cpu_smt_flags() to derive the flags for SMT domain. No functional changes intended.
